How much do farm workers make in Italy?

Farm workers in Italy typically earn between €1,200 and €1,500 per month, depending on experience, region, and the type of farm. Wages may also vary based on seasonal work, with some workers earning additional bonuses or overtime pay for extended hours.

What are farm jobs in Italy?

Farm jobs in Italy typically involve working on agricultural farms, vineyards, orchards, or olive groves. These positions may include planting, harvesting, pruning, packing produce, or caring for livestock. Many of these jobs are seasonal and attract both local and international workers, especially during harvest periods. Some roles may offer room and board as part of the compensation. Knowledge of Italian can be helpful but is not always required, especially for manual labor positions.

What are some common challenges faced by workers in farm jobs in Italy, and how can they be addressed?

Workers in farm jobs in Italy often encounter challenges such as physically demanding tasks, long hours during peak harvest seasons, and adapting to varying weather conditions. Effective communication with supervisors, staying hydrated, and using proper techniques for lifting and repetitive tasks can help manage these challenges. Many farms provide training and protective equipment, and working as part of a team can foster a supportive environment. Additionally, understanding seasonal workflows and being flexible with schedules can make the experience more rewarding.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in farm jobs in Italy?

To thrive in farm jobs in Italy, you generally need physical stamina, basic agricultural knowledge, and a willingness to perform manual labor, often without formal qualifications required. Familiarity with farming machinery, irrigation systems, and sometimes knowledge of organic farming practices are valuable assets. Strong teamwork, adaptability, and good communication—often in Italian—help individuals integrate smoothly into multicultural teams and handle changing tasks. These skills ensure efficient farm operations, productivity, and a safe working environment.
